At its core, a Treasury Money Market Fund earns income primarily through short-term U.S. government notes and bills. These instruments carry very low default risk, making them a safe haven during market volatility. The fund reinvests cash flows promptly, enabling consistent compounding of earnings over time.

Because treasury notes have predictable maturities—ranging from a few weeks to one year—the fund maintains a steady earning pace aligned with changing interest rates. Unlike savings accounts subject to fluctuating rates and caps, money market funds often yield above-normal returns with minimal volatility. This balance supports gradual, secure growth, which appeals to risk-aware investors focused on preserving purchasing power in uncertain economic conditions.
